--[[
symbol group name parser field
------ ---------- ------------
s syllablesStart parser_data["start"]
m syllablesMiddle parser_data["middle"]
e syllablesEnd parser_data["end"]
P syllablesPre parser_data["pre"]
p syllablesPost parser_data["post"]
v phonemesVocals parser_data["vocals"]
c phonemesConsonants parser_data["consonants"]
A customGroupA parser_data["cga"]
B customGroupB parser_data["cgb"]
... (custom groups exist from `A` to `O`)
N customGroupN parser_data["cgn"]
O customGroupO parser_data["cgo"]
? phonemesVocals/ parser_data["vocals"]/
phonemesConsonants parser_data["consonants"]
]]

-- ======================
-- WORD VALIDATION
-- ======================
-- check for occurrences of triple characters (case-insensitive)
local function word_has_triples(str)
local str = str:lower()
for i = 1, #str - 2 do
local a = str:sub(i, i)
local b = str:sub(i+1, i+1)
local c = str:sub(i+2, i+2)
if a == b and a == c then
return true
end
end
return false
end
-- check for occurrences of illegal strings (case-insensitive)
local function word_has_illegal(data, str)
local str = str:lower()
if not data.illegal then return false end
for i = 1, #data.illegal do
if str:find(data.illegal[i]) then
return true
end
end
return false
end
-- check for repeated syllables (case-insensitive)
local function word_repeated_syllables(str)
local word = str:lower():gsub("['%-_]", "")
for step = 2, math.min(5, math.floor(#str / 2)) do
for i = 1, #word - step + 1 do
local search = word:sub(i, i + step - 1)
local sub = word:sub(i + step, (i + step) + step - 1)
if search == sub then
return true
end
ng_debug("not repeatted", str, step, search, sub)
end
end
return false
end
-- verify if the word passes the above checks
local function word_is_ok(data, str)
return ((#str > 0) and
not word_has_triples(str) and
not word_has_illegal(data, str) and
not word_repeated_syllables(str))
end
-- removes double, leading and ending spaces
local function word_prune_spaces(str)
str = str:gsub(" +$", "")
str = str:gsub("^ +", "")
str = str:gsub(" +", " ")
return str
end
